The tariff classification of a toy armament from Taiwan
Issued August 16, 1991 by U.S. Customs and Border Protection.
Tariff classification
HTS codes: 9503.90.6000
Headings: 9503

NY 865498 August 16, 1991 CLA-2-95:S:N:N3D:225-865498 CATEGORY: Classification TARIFF NO.: 9503.90.6000 Ms. Betsy N. Wolkens Hayes Specialties Corporation 1761 East Genesee Saginaw, Michigan 48601 RE: The tariff classification of a toy armament from Taiwan Dear Ms. Wolkens: This classification decision under the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S) is being issued in accordance with the provisions of Section 177 of the Customs Regulations (19 C.F.R. 177). DATE OF INQUIRY : June 28, 1991, received in this office on July 29, 1991 DESCRIPTION OF MERCHANDISE : The item is called a "Bomb Bag". The cellophane package measures approximately 4" X 3 1/4". The bag displays a military action picture on one side and instructions on the other. Contents includes citric acid and baking soda which causes the bag to pop open (explode) after squeezing. HTS PROVISION : Other toys (except models), not having a spring mechanism HTS SUBHEADING : 9503.90.6000 RATE OF DUTY : 6.8 percent ad valorem A copy of this ruling letter should be attached to the entry documents filed at the time this merchandise is imported. If the documents have been filed without a copy, this ruling should be brought to the attention of the Customs officer handling the transaction. Sincerely, Jean F. Maguire Area Director New York Seaport
